What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Nace Level 2 position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a NACE Level 2 Coating Inspector, you need solid knowledge of surface preparation, coating application, and inspection techniques, usually supported by a NACE Level 2 certification. Experience with inspection tools such as dry film thickness gauges, holiday detectors, and familiarity with industry standards (e.g., SSPC, ASTM) is essential. Attention to detail, strong report writing, and effective communication are valuable soft skills for success in this role. These skills and qualities are critical to ensure coatings meet project specifications and safety standards, minimizing risks of corrosion and asset failure.

What is a NACE Level 2 job?

A NACE Level 2 job typically involves inspecting and evaluating protective coatings on various structures to prevent corrosion. Professionals at this level have advanced knowledge of surface preparation, coating application, and inspection techniques. They are responsible for ensuring compliance with industry standards, documenting findings, and sometimes supervising Level 1 inspectors. NACE Level 2 certification indicates proficiency in both theory and practical aspects of coating inspection. These roles are commonly found in industries like oil and gas, marine, and infrastructure.

What are some typical daily responsibilities of a NACE Level 2 Coating Inspector?

A NACE Level 2 Coating Inspector is responsible for inspecting surface preparation and coating application on various structures, documenting findings, and ensuring processes comply with industry standards and client specifications. Daily tasks often include using specialized inspection tools, preparing detailed reports, attending project meetings, and providing guidance to contractors on-site. The role requires consistent coordination with project managers, contractors, and quality assurance teams to resolve issues and ensure the quality and longevity of protective coatings. This hands-on position is integral to preventing premature asset deterioration and supporting overall project goals.

KTA-Tator, Inc. (KTA) is a 100% employee-owned materials engineering firm, internationally recognized as a leading expert in corrosion protection and asset integrity. Five business units comprise the $40 million enterprise offering a broad range of coatings, steel, concrete fabrication and building envelope inspection, evaluation, and testing services in nearly every market and industry.
KTA is recruiting experienced AMPP Senior Certified Coating Inspectors (NACE Level 3)ย open to traveling across the U.S. for extensive periods of time. Opportunities are open to candidates with the following qualifications:

  • High School Diploma or GED equivalent
  • AMPPย Senior Certified Coatings Inspector (NACE CIP Level 3)
  • Reliable Transportation and valid driverโ€™s license
  • Excellent work ethic withย good oral and written communication and decision making skills
  • Detail and customer oriented
  • Computer proficiency, including Microsoft Word and Excel skills

Preferred Additional Qualifications:

  • 2-5ย yearsโ€™ bridge coatings inspection experienceย 
  • SSPC Lead Paint Removal (C3)
  • Bridge Coatings Inspector (BCI) Level 1 or 2

Physical Requirements:

  • Close, color, distance, depth vision, and ability to adjust focus;
  • Ability to travel extensively and ability to work outside (including inclement weather); and
  • Climbing, bending, crawling, and working in confined spaces and on uneven terrain.
